If you have ever used KMA Motors at Hidden Meadow, Brown Heath Road, Christleton you will know what an efficient, friendly and personal service they provide. I am sorry to say that we could loose this useful local business. KMA is being threatened by a planning application by the owner of the land to replace the existing steel workshop with a four room office building.
